Lynden, WA, is a city of just under 15,000 people located in the mild climate of northwest Washington, four miles south of the Canadian border and 15 miles north of Bellingham. The natural beauty of Mount Baker and the San Juan Islands as well as the metropolitan attractions of Seattle and Vancouver, B.C. all are nearby.

PeaceHealth has been serving the communities of northwest Washington since 1890 with PeaceHealth St. Joseph Medical Center, now a 253-bed, two-campus hospital providing a Level II Trauma Center and a full range of inpatient and outpatient services. PeaceHealth's Whatcom Region also includes the comprehensive heart care services of the Cardiovascular Center at PeaceHealth St. Joseph Medical Center as well as the primary and specialty care provided by PeaceHealth Medical Group.
